Ticket: Staging env misconfigured for Siftgate bloom filter

The bloom layer in front of the Pellet KV store is rejecting all lookups in staging because the env file was copied from the dev template without credentials. False-positive tuning values are fine; only the auth line is missing. To unblock the weekly demo, the Pellet admission secret must be set on the following line.

env line for yaguf-fajop: LEDGER_TOKEN13=fb08984397349

## Step 4 — Migrate Flag Definitions (Switchyard)

Export legacy flags with `swy export --legacy`, then import into the new Switchyard store. Audit fields (`created_by`, `changed_at`) are preserved; review them for tamper evidence. Rollout rules are re-evaluated on import, so diff the before/after states. For the review, read-only access to the flag store is granted via the string below.

replica DSN, kajep-yahag: mssql://praok_svc:iF@db-8d68.plorvaio.local:5432/eliion

Hi Teren,

Handing off the Glyphbox work. We're moving all third-party fonts from CDN loads into the vendored `assets/fonts` tree; about two-thirds are migrated. The license manifest is updated for each family as it lands — don't vendor anything without an entry there. One open issue: the variable-weight family renders wrong in the staging build, likely a subsetting flag. Build scripts are documented in the repo wiki. If licensing questions come up overnight, contact the platform legal liaison at the address below.

pager mailbox: silael.sorwyn.tamius@zemvarsys.corp